RhinoLands / Lands Design License Modes

RhinoLands / Lands Design has five license modes:

Viewer

Lands Design runs in Viewer mode when the evaluation period has expired. When this happens, you can open and save documents that contain Lands Design objects, but editing features are disabled:

Evaluation

All Lands Design features are fully functional during the trial period. No product key is required.

Network (only in Rhino)

Use a Lands Design license acquired from the Zoo server. Zoo server software with the Lands Design Zoo plug-in (both free) lets you share Lands Design licenses (product keys) among users on the same network workgroup. When Lands Design is installed as a workgroup node instead of stand-alone, it works like this:
  • When a workgroup node starts, it requests a license from the Zoo.
  • An unused license is assigned to the node.
  • When a node shuts down, the license is returned to the Zoo license pool.

Cloud (only in Rhino)

Use a Lands Design license acquired from the Cloud Zoo server. The Cloud Zoo server is a free service provided by McNeel that lets you manage the Lands Design license online.
  • For individual users, use the Rhino Accounts login to use Lands Design on any computer worldwide.
  • For corporations and schools, Cloud Zoo can simplify license distribution. Organizations can create a pool of licenses and share the licenses with team members.
  • Work online or offline. No need to check out licenses, so you should not be caught out on the road without a license.
  • Licensing will even work without a constant internet connection.
